Here are some ideas to help minimize risk and keep your home safe this winter.
1. Inspect and replace (as necessary) water-supply hoses to washing machines, toilets, and sinks.
2. Install a low-temperature alarm if you are away often to prevent pipe freezing.
3. Shut off the water supply when you go on vacation.
4. Install heat sensors in your kitchen and near your furnace.
5. Insulate unfinished rooms to prevent pipe freezing.
6. Ventilate the attic to prevent roof icing and to clear snow from the roof.
